Dance Ministry
Dance is a spiritual tool and has been used as a form of worship for thousands of years. Worship through dance is mentioned in the Bible several times and is significant part in church history. Dance can be used to interpret Bible stories and life experiences.
A Christian dancer dances for an audience of one. In other words, a Christian dancer dances for God and praises Him through the hand and body movements.
The Dance Ministry has established a dance training program and the rules and goals of the program are simple. Dancers must be willing to leave their pride at the door and to focus completely on worshipping God with each dance step. Body types, abilities, and training are not as important as the desire for spiritual growth and focus on God.
A person who has the heart and willingness to dance for the Lord can learn through faithful attendance at the rehearsals and trainings, although innate talent in dance is a plus factor. Usually the training program starts by warm up exercise, then the practice proper, and ends up in a Bible Study. Classical dance techniques like ballet and tambourine dance are taught in the training program. Even hip-hop dances are taught to glorify God.
